Line | Code |
3161 | * The dynamic portion of the hook name, `$feature`, refers to the specific |
3162 | * theme feature. See add_theme_support() for the list of possible values. |
3163 | * |
3164 | * @since 3.4.0 |
3165 | * |
3166 | * @param bool $supports Whether the active theme supports the given feature. Default true. |
3167 | * @param array $args Array of arguments for the feature. |
3168 | * @param string $feature The theme feature. |
3169 | */ |
3170 | return apply_filters( "current_theme_supports-{$feature}", true, $args, $_wp_theme_features[ $feature ] ); // phpcs:ignore WordPress.NamingConventions.ValidHookName.UseUnderscores |
3171 | } |
